Mechanical Engineer Bulk Material Handling
About the job Mechanical Engineer Bulk Material Handling
Position Summary:
- The Mechanical Engineer will be responsible for the design, engineering, and coordination of bulk material handling systems and fabricated mechanical structures within EPCM projects. The role involves developing technical solutions, ensuring compliance with engineering standards, and supporting the execution of projects such as conveyor systems, crushing stations, fuel storage tanks, and jetty mechanical works.
Key Responsibilities:
- Design, review, and optimize bulk material handling systems including conveyors, chutes, hoppers, feeders, stackers, and transfer towers.
- Prepare and review detailed engineering documents such as specifications, datasheets, P&IDs, GA drawings, and fabrication details.
- Provide engineering input for fabrication works including tanks, pressure vessels, structural supports, and piping systems.
- Ensure designs comply with SNI, ASME, API, ISO, CEMA, and international standards.
- Conduct mechanical calculations including load, torque, stress, and material selection for handling equipment.
- Support procurement by preparing technical requisitions, evaluating vendor offers, and reviewing vendor drawings.
- Coordinate with drafting team to produce accurate fabrication drawings and material take-offs (MTOs).
- Work closely with civil, electrical, and structural teams to ensure integrated and constructible designs.
- Provide technical support during workshop fabrication, site installation, and commissioning.
- Participate in design reviews, HAZOP, and quality checks to ensure compliance with safety and operational requirements.
- Support preparation of BoQs, cost estimates, and schedules for mechanical works.
- Mentor junior engineers and ensure knowledge transfer within the mechanical discipline.
Qualifications & Experience:
- Bachelors Degree in Mechanical Engineering (S1) or equivalent.
- 5-10 years experience in mechanical engineering within EPC/EPCM projects.
- Strong background in bulk material handling systems (belt conveyors, chutes, crushers, feeders, stackers).
- Proven experience in fabrication of tanks, mechanical equipment, and structural assemblies.
- Proficiency in AutoCAD, SolidWorks, or similar CAD tools. Knowledge of analysis software (SAP2000, ANSYS) is an advantage.
- Familiarity with welding, fabrication processes, and QA/QC requirements.
- Strong knowledge of SNI, ASME, API, CEMA, and other international standards.
- Good communication, problem-solving, and project coordination skills.
- Ability to work effectively in a multidisciplinary EPCM environment and manage multiple projects simultaneously.
